Transaction 4fd73f5099231e34242228990b925649c4fc919602cf27f84466c07c49426821

1 Input
1 Outputs
  • 4fd73f5099231e34242228990b925649c4fc919602cf27f84466c07c49426821:0
  • value  126266
    address  399zDMHBLjM4s1GUeRu2pyL9yJqbXXfQJZ